Transaction 733ffc599fd74a79c33ec91c8721a28bd32023a60954943284ac067f98628b85

1 Input
2 Outputs
  • 733ffc599fd74a79c33ec91c8721a28bd32023a60954943284ac067f98628b85:0
  • value  458669
    address  16nBwyn8CoKLPetyPw8EGTG6oqpCDz3sfq
  • 733ffc599fd74a79c33ec91c8721a28bd32023a60954943284ac067f98628b85:1
  • value  121312545
    address  1CgfYGkyTsZjcG9f1wjVR4oxC4FCdtYkhA